What Is a U-Sectional Sofa?

A U-shaped sectional sofa wraps seating around three sides, creating an enclosed, facing layout that looks like the letter U from above. Unlike an L-shaped sectional that covers two sides, a U-shape adds a third run of seating, which significantly increases capacity and creates a natural gathering space in the centre.

Ideal Sizes and Layouts for U-Sectionals

U-sectionals need room to breathe. A general guideline is to have at least 12 to 14 feet of usable space across both directions to accommodate a full U-shaped configuration comfortably. That means measuring the actual usable patio space, not just the overall dimensions, before deciding how many modules you need.

The U-sectional runs along three sides of the space with the opening facing the main entry point or entertainment area. A coffee or side table placed in the centre completes the layout.

U-Sectionals vs. L-Shaped Sectionals

An L-shaped sectional covers two sides and works well in most rooms. A U-shaped sectional sofa covers three sides and works better in larger spaces where additional seating is needed, and the room can handle the footprint. The L is more versatile across different room sizes. The U is better for dedicated family lounges, media rooms, and outdoor entertaining spaces where capacity and the enclosed feel are the priority.

For families who regularly have six or more people seated at once, the U-shape is almost always the better choice.

How to Choose the Right U-Sectional for Your Family

Count the seats needed first. A six to seven seater U-sectional covers most family households comfortably. Then measure the space and map the footprint with tape before buying. The opening of the U should face the main use direction, whether that is a TV, a view, or an outdoor entertaining area.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Buying a U-Sectional

Undersizing is the most common mistake. A U-shaped sectional couch that looks substantial in a showroom can disappear in a real outdoor space or large room. When in doubt, add one more module.

Not leaving enough clearance around the opening is the other one. The open end of the U needs at least 18 to 24 inches of clear space so movement in and out of the seating area feels natural rather than awkward.
